mm/page_alloc: avoid overcounting bulk alloc in watermark check
alloc_pages_bulk_noprof() only fills NULL slots and already tracks how
many entries are pre-populated via nr_populated.
The fast watermark check was adding nr_pages unconditionally, which can
overestimate the demand. Use (nr_pages - nr_populated) instead, as an
upper bound on the remaining pages this call can still allocate without
scanning the whole array.
